11/30/12 Dear Parents and Guardians, Report cards will be coming home next week. It is a perfect time to reflect on homework and work habits. Homework is a necessary step to help reinforce the skills and concepts learned at school. It provides additional practice for those skills that need to become automatic. Homework also helps students develop responsibility and organization, which are life long skills. Time management is key when working with your children on homework. The holiday season can become a busy time for all of us. Here are some suggestions to help you and your child stay on track for
accomplishing goals.
-Have a family calendar to record the fun events as well as due dates for assignments.
-Use the assignment notebook each day. It is a great form of communication as well as an organizational tool.
-Arrange a consistent time and place for homework to get done. Good habits begin with establishing a study place
in your home.
-Discuss routines. Agree on the best time to study for a test or complete those weekly assignments ahead of time.
-Long-term assignments may require materials. Make a list before beginning projects to avoid late night trips to
the store.
-Celebrate success! Help your child feel proud of their hard work. That pride will motivate them when they feel
challenged.
-If you notice your child having difficulty with homework, review the directions together. Break steps down to
help them feel less overwhelmed. Woodview staff is dedicated to working with you and your child to achieve success. Please communicate with us if
there are any homework concerns. We are happy to assist you.

Flu Season and School
To help keep flu outbreaks to a minimum, we are asking that all students and families follow these simple steps:
1. PLEASE keep sick children home from school until they are fever-free for 24 hours without medication, such as Tylenol or Ibuprofen. (fever = 99.5 degrees or above) and their cough is gone!
2. Teach your children to COVER THEIR COUGHS and wash hands often. Hand sanitizers are also effective.
3. The CDC recommends that all school-age children receive flu vaccinations. Seasonal flu vaccines are available now!
4. Prepare in advance. Have alternative childcare available if you cannot stay home or pick up your sick child at school. SICK students cannot remain at school!
5. PLEASE report your child’s absence to school and tell us the symptoms. (Just saying “sick” doesn’t help us track illnesses)
6. Make sure we have current phone numbers to reach you and your emergency contacts.
